Brian Williams exemplifies the role of a dedicated grandfather. His daughter, the actress Allison Williams, openly discussed the deep connection Brian has with her young son, Arlo.

Allison married Alexander Dreymond in a private ceremony, which was publicly confirmed in January of this year.

During a recent promotional interview on Today for her new movie, Megan 2.0, host Savannah Guthrie commented to Allison, “I hear he’s fully embracing his role as a grandpa with little Arlo right now.” Allison responded enthusiastically, praising her father’s grandparenting skills. “He’s an absolutely amazing grandfather. They’re incredibly involved. Just last night, both of my parents were there, participating in his whole bedtime routine. I feel incredibly fortunate. It truly does take a village. Living so closely to them allows us to have a genuine, close-knit, multi-generational caregiving experience. I’m extremely grateful for that.”

Guthrie was curious about what Arlo calls his grandfather. “What does he call him? I remember calling him B-Dubs.” Allison chuckled and replied, “It’s close. He calls him Bub. And Arlo tries to say it as Bububub. He’s only three, so he’s still getting the hang of it.”

Like her father, Allison tends to keep her personal life very private. Nevertheless, she recently shared her harrowing experience during Arlo’s birth.

Speaking with Amanda Hirsch on the Not Skinny But Not Fat podcast, Allison recounted the stressful birth. “As soon as I got there, his heart rate started dropping. It was incredibly traumatic,” she described the tense moments before an unplanned surgical procedure. “It was profoundly stressful. At that moment, I realized I hadn’t even considered the possibility of needing a C-section.”

About her birth expectations, she continued, “I hadn’t envisioned it, hadn’t really thought about what it would be like. I was like, ‘Blah blah blah, I’ve never had surgery, I don’t want to think about this.’ And so, I didn’t.”

“That was a terrifying realization when I understood that I was about to undergo surgery for the first time,” she explained further. “It all felt incredibly frightening and far from what I had imagined. When they told me it was happening, I was overwhelmed with thoughts like, ‘What’s going to happen to me? What will this be like? What does this mean?’ If I had known some of these answers beforehand, maybe I would have just been processing thoughts like, ‘This isn’t what I envisioned,’ or ‘I’m scared,’ or ‘This feels vulnerable.’
